Required: MUST HAVE SOLID UNDERSTANDING OF JAVA FUNDAMENTALS
Ideal candidate should have 8+ years of strong Java experience in designing, developing, testing and successfully deploying critical and complex projects.
- Must have strong Java skills with experience in the development of concurrent and distributed systems.
- Should have experience working with Java 8 features, especially Streams API.
- Must have 5+ years of advanced experience with Spring-based technologies (Spring Boot, Spring Cloud, etc.) and caching frameworks like Hazelcast.
- Must have 5+ years of SQL knowledge and experience.
- Role requires experience in designing and implementing microservices-based solutions, writing unit/integration tests, and writing SQL queries with a good understanding of data models.
- Should possess exposure to AWS cloud (EC2, ECS, Load Balancer, Security Group, Lambda, S3, etc.).
- Strong analytical and problem-solving skills.
Good to have:
- Experience in DevOps development and deployment using Docker and containers.
#J-18808-Ljbffr